Joris Kramer will play for Go Ahead Eagles next season. The 24-year-old defender extends his contract with AZ until the summer of 2023 and is rented to the brand new Eredivisionist from Deventer. The left-footed central defender has to compete with Justin Bakker.

Kramer has been through the AZ youth academy since the Under-14s. In the Alkmaar main force, the defender has played one official game so far. On August 18, 2019, he made his debut against FC Groningen.

Last season, Kramer was rented to SC Cambuur, with which he won the championship in the Kitchen Champion Division. The defender came to 22 league matches, although he mostly participated as a substitute. He has already played more than a hundred matches in the Eerste Divisie.

“I was actually quite impressed with the way Go Ahead Eagles played last season,” says Kramer. “The organization within the team was good and the players knew exactly what to expect from each other in the field. There was a clear plan, nice to see. In that regard, Cambuur had three games very difficult against Go Ahead Eagles last season. Ultimately it worked out well for both clubs due to the promotion to the Eredivisie. ”

Kramer is now the fourth addition to the new season at Go Ahead Eagles. Previously Isac Lidberg (Gefle IF), Ragnar Oratmangoen (SC Cambuur) and Philippe Rommens (TOP Oss) were already attracted by the Deventer Eredivisionist. With Oratmangoen and Kramer, the club is taking two champions from the Kitchen Champion Division to the Eredivisie.
